Prediction
In order to deliver the right message to the right customer at the right time, predictive analytics are becoming more and more necessary.
According to the 2015 State of Predictive Marketing Survey Report, “predictive marketing is the practice of extracting information from existing customer datasets to determine a pattern and predict future outcomes and trends.”
It has the ability to increase engagement and conversion, reducing customer research on the product and making decision-making easier.
Automation
Artificial Intelligence is conquering the Process Automation industry. This is called Intelligent Process Automation, and this technology has improved the development of various repetitive tasks. These include contact management, lead scoring, email marketing, and list segmentation, among others. In turn, this allows businesses to reduce costs, increase capacity, and improve the quality of their output.

Why Is A.I. the Future of Marketing?
The implementation of Artificial Intelligence in the field of marketing will help companies build a customer-centric culture that adapts quickly to changing market needs. This will allow results to be optimized, saving time and money.
It will have additional benefits, according to a BCG analysis, such as a faster impact, higher incremental revenue, better consumer experience and enhanced capabilities.
